Downtown Collingwood Continues To Grow
Putting Pressure On Need To
Create More Parking
The parking debate is on again in Downtown Collingwood. The Town is seeking public input to assist in the preparation of a long term strategy for parking in the Town of Collingwood.
The BA Consulting Group has been retained by the Town of Collingwood to develop the long term strategy. A part of the research will deal with the cash-in-lieu of parking requirement for all business and development in the Town of Collingwood.
Questions to be examined throughout the study process include who should pay for parking, should there be an increase in parking lots and if so, where should the parking lots be located. Developer parking costs will be examined in the study along with whether or not special attention should be paid to encourage active transportation. Parking rates will be examined including looking at whether different parking lots should offer different parking rates. Also, the ongoing issue of staff parking in the downtown core will be examined.
